Abstract

We report the case of an HIV-infected patient who presented with acute renal failure due to visceral leishmaniasis (VL). Although renal failure is the leading cause of death in dogs, the natural reservoir of Leishmania infantum, renal involvement is usually absent in human VL. However, L. infantum can be considered a cause of renal failure in HIV-infected patients.
